原文:第四十五个知识点:描述一些对抗RSA侧信道攻击的基础防御方法

第四十五个知识点:描述一些对抗RSA侧信道攻击的基础防御方法 原文地址:http: bristolcrypto.blogspot.com things number describe some basic.html 为了让这篇文章保持简单,我们将会我们将讨论所谓的 香草 RSA 在加密中不使用随机性 ,并强调少量潜在的侧通道攻击和对策。 让我们回顾一下简单的RSA加密方案。 密钥生成:选择一对秘密 ...

2020-01-31 15:57 0 840 推荐指数:

查看详情

十五个知识点:RSA-OAEP和ECIES的密钥生成,加密和解密

十五个知识点:RSA-OAEP和ECIES的密钥生成,加密和解密 1.RSA-OAEP RSA-OAEP是RSA加密方案和OAEP填充方案的同时使用.现实世界中它们同时使用.(这里介绍的只是"textbook rsa-oaep") 1.1 RSA[1] RSA是一种最早的公钥加密场景 ...

Thu Jan 30 22:18:00 CST 2020 0 1866
第三十九个知识点:信道攻击和故障攻击有什么区别

第三十九个知识点:信道攻击和故障攻击有什么区别 信道攻击(Side-channel attacks, SCA)是一类攻击者尝试通过观察信道泄露来推测目标计算的信息。(例如,时间,功率消耗,电磁辐射,噪声等。) 故障攻击(Fault attacks, FA)是一类攻击,在这种攻击中,攻击 ...

Thu Jan 30 22:42:00 CST 2020 1 1107
RSA相关知识点攻击方法

相关工具/方法 大数分解 大数分解网页 http://www.factordb.com/index.php yafu 运行yafu-x64.exe,在窗口中输入factor(n),n即为待分解的大数。 在factor.log中找到分解结果。 利用z3解方程 可以加快解题 ...

Thu Jul 30 01:38:00 CST 2020 0 1143
第四十八个知识点:TPM的目的和使用方法

第四十八个知识点:TPM的目的和使用方法 在检查TPM目的之前,值得去尝试理解TPM设计出来的目的是为了克服什么样的问题。真正的问题是信任。信任什么?首先内存和软件运行在电脑上。这些东西能直接的通过操作系统进行获取,因此能在操作系统层级的攻击者可以访问秘密信息(例如安全密钥)。:如果这些密钥直接 ...

Sat Feb 01 04:57:00 CST 2020 0 1202
第四十五课:MVC,MVP,MVVM的区别

前端架构从MVC到MVP,再到MVVM,它们都有不同的应用场景。但MVVM已经被证实为界面开发最好的方案了。 MVP 是从经典的模式MVC演变而来,它们的基本思想有相通的地方:Controller/ ...

Fri Jan 16 18:57:00 CST 2015 3 1791
第三十八个知识点:隐蔽信道信道的区别

第三十八个知识点:隐蔽信道信道的区别 隐蔽信道信道是两种不同的信息泄露信道 隐蔽信道使用目的不是通信的机制。例如,写和检查文件是否被锁传递信号'1'或者'0'。在隐蔽通道中,内部处理器及那个不允许外部处理器访问的信息泄露给外部处理器。内部处理器(发送方)可能是之前植入的木马程序。外部 ...

Thu Jan 30 22:41:00 CST 2020 1 823
WEB前端开发 必会的二十五个知识点

1. 常用那几种浏览器测试?有哪些内核(Layout Engine)?(Q1) 浏览器:IE,Chrome,FireFox,Safari,Opera。(Q2) 内核:Trident,Gecko,Pre ...

Sat Jul 30 08:06:00 CST 2016 0 2691
第四十七个知识点:什么是Fiat-Shamir变换?

第四十七个知识点:什么是Fiat-Shamir变换? 只要Alice和Bob同时在线,Sigma协议能快速的完成Alice向Bob证明的任务。Alice向Bob发送承诺,Bob返回一个挑战,最后Alice给出一个回应。不幸的是,没有进一步的修改,Sigma协议实际上不是零知识的:它们仅仅是诚实 ...

Sat Feb 01 04:20:00 CST 2020 0 1358
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M